fix EBADF unqueueing in select backend (Trac #10590)
Alexander found a interesting case:
1. We have a queue of two waiters in a blocked_queue
2. first file descriptor changes state to RUNNABLE,
second changes to INVALID
3. awaitEvent function dequeued RUNNABLE thread to a
run queue and attempted to dequeue INVALID descriptor
to a run queue.
Unqueueing INVALID fails thusly:
#3 0x000000000045cf1c in barf (s=0x4c1cb0 "removeThreadFromDeQueue: not found")
at rts/RtsMessages.c:42
#4 0x000000000046848b in removeThreadFromDeQueue (...) at rts/Threads.c:249
#5 0x000000000049a120 in removeFromQueues (...) at rts/RaiseAsync.c:719
#6 0x0000000000499502 in throwToSingleThreaded__ (...) at rts/RaiseAsync.c:67
#7 0x0000000000499555 in throwToSingleThreaded (..) at rts/RaiseAsync.c:75
#8 0x000000000047c27d in awaitEvent (wait=rtsFalse) at rts/posix/Select.c:415
The problem here is a throwToSingleThreaded function that tries
to unqueue a TSO from blocked_queue, but awaitEvent function
leaves blocked_queue in a inconsistent state while traverses
over blocked_queue:
case RTS_FD_IS_READY:
IF_DEBUG(scheduler,
debugBelch("Waking up blocked thread %lu\n",
(unsigned long)tso->id));
tso->why_blocked = NotBlocked;
tso->_link = END_TSO_QUEUE; // Here we break the queue head
pushOnRunQueue(&MainCapability,tso);
break;
